CNY Tim Posted March 1, 2007 Share Posted March 1, 2007 Tyler - If you cant get em to go on a small YBD (Your Bobbers Down), you and Bud may want to order some 2mm, 3mm and even 4mm wolframs, epoxy and handpainted jigs. There tungsten so you can go super small without giving up the weight as these jigs are heavier than lead. If you have thrown YBD's on 1 pd test or less and they won't bite go home... If it's crappies try the Berkley Power Honeyworms they love em around here. We have North Shores party here Saturday night so I have to stay close but there's always next weekend.
